Understanding eSignatures
eSignatures, or electronic signatures, are a modern and convenient way to sign documents without the need for physical ink and paper. These digital signatures have become increasingly popular due to their ease of use and ability to streamline business processes. However, many individuals and businesses have concerns about the legality of eSignatures and whether they hold the same weight as traditional signatures on paper. Legal Recognition of eSignatures
One of the primary concerns surrounding eSignatures is whether they are legally recognized. The good news is that eSignatures are indeed legally valid in many countries, including the United States. In 2000, the United States passed the Electronic Signatures in Global and National Commerce (ESIGN) Act, which established the legality of eSignatures for most business and personal transactions. Additionally, many states have adopted the Uniform Electronic Transactions Act (UETA), further solidifying the legal standing of eSignatures.
Factors for Valid eSignatures
While eSignatures are legally valid, there are certain factors that must be met to ensure their validity. First and foremost, both parties involved in the transaction must consent to the use of eSignatures. Additionally, there must be a clear and unambiguous way to associate the eSignature with the signer, such as through a unique login or authentication process.
Benefits of eSignatures
Aside from their legal validity, eSignatures offer a multitude of benefits for individuals and businesses. The convenience of being able to sign documents from anywhere with an internet connection saves time and eliminates the need for physical meetings or mailing of papers. Additionally, eSignatures can speed up the overall process of document signing, resulting in faster turnaround times for contracts, agreements, and other important paperwork.
Ensuring Security and Integrity
When it comes to eSignatures, the security and integrity of the signing process are of utmost importance. To ensure that eSignatures are legally valid and cannot be tampered with, it’s crucial to use a reputable eSignature platform that offers features such as encryption, audit trails, and multi-factor authentication. By using a trusted eSignature solution, individuals and businesses can have peace of mind knowing that their electronic signatures are secure and legally sound.
